A Spectacular End-of-Year Lineup at The Royal Albert Hall

Courtesy: The Royal Albert Hall

The Royal Albert Hall is set to close the year with a spectacular lineup of events featuring a diverse array of shows and performances. Some of the UK’s most beloved stars and musical talents, including Sandi Toksvig, Trevor Nelson, Jamie Cullum, Anna Lapwood and Paloma Faith, will take to the stage, offering something for everyone in the lead-up to the holiday season.

Kicking off the festive season on Friday, December 6, is jazz maestro Jamie Cullum, who will perform his show Pianoman alongside a big band. Fans of jazz will also enjoy Guy Barker’s Big Band Christmas on December 9, where the acclaimed trumpeter will be joined by a host of special guests. Among them are Paloma Faith, saxophonist Giacomo Smith, soul singer Vanessa Haynes and vocalists Tony Momrelle and Clare Teal, making it a star-studded night for jazz and soul enthusiasts.

Tony Momrelle will return to the stage alongside BBC Radio 2 DJ Trevor Nelson for Trevor Nelson’s Soul Christmas on December 16. This sell-out event, which has captivated audiences since 2019, will feature performances from stars like Kimberley Davis and Kenny Thomas, with accompaniment from the BBC Concert Orchestra and Kingdom Choir, conducted by Troy Miller. Nelson's carefully curated blend of soul classics and festive tunes promises another memorable evening for attendees.

In keeping with the Royal Albert Hall’s rich tradition of family-friendly events, Sandi Toksvig will host Sandi Claus Is Coming to Town on December 18. This event will be a joyous, queer celebration featuring the London Gay Men’s Chorus, organist Anna Lapwood, tap dancers from Laine Theatre Arts and the BBC Concert Orchestra, all under the baton of Karen Ní Bhroin. It's sure to be a night filled with laughter, fun and inclusivity for all ages.

For those seeking more traditional Christmas fare, The Royal Albert Hall’s renowned sing-along carol concerts begin on December 14, with 16 opportunities to join in the festivities until Christmas Eve. A highlight will be a special performance by the Royal Choral Society, continuing its 152-year tradition of performing at the Hall during the holidays. Additionally, the London Community Gospel Choir will deliver a powerful set of Christmas songs and gospel classics, ensuring that the festive spirit is in full swing.

Classical music lovers are in for a treat as Welsh mezzo-soprano Katherine Jenkins returns to the Hall for a special performance of seasonal favourites, while Letters Live, the ever-popular epistolary event, will celebrate the 200th anniversary of the RSPCA. This unique show features actors reading letters from history, with past participants including stars like Benedict Cumberbatch, Olivia Colman and Woody Harrelson. The event is renowned for its surprise lineups, making each performance an exciting and unpredictable occasion.

Finally, the end-of-year celebrations culminate with the Birmingham Royal Ballet’s breathtaking production of The Nutcracker. This sumptuous, specially adapted version of the beloved ballet will bring an enchanting close to the Hall’s holiday season.
